Step 1: If you ever find yourself lost in a sea of zoomed-in, rotated, or panned views in Blender, don't panic. The first step to resetting your view is to simply press the 'Home' key on your keyboard. This will instantly snap your view back to the default position, giving you a clear view of your project.
Step 2: If pressing 'Home' doesn't quite do the trick and you need a more specific reset, fear not! You can easily reset the view of a specific editor in Blender by opening the 'View' menu and selecting 'View All' or 'Center View to Cursor' depending on your needs. This will ensure that you have a focused and centered view of your project, ready to continue working without any distractions.
Step 3: Another useful tip for resetting your view is to make use of the nifty 'View' options in the toolbar. By simply clicking on the 'View' tab, you can find options such as 'Frame Selected' and 'Align View' which can help you quickly reset and align your view to specific objects or elements in your project. This can be extremely handy when working on complex scenes or intricate details that require precision and attention.
